Decoding the Table Layout

The entire game revolves around predicting the outcomes of a single roll of three distinct six-sided dice. The visual layout of a traditional game board serves as a map of every possible outcome you can wager on, arranged from low-variance choices to high-risk propositions. Understanding how to read this geometric layout step by step is the first major technique to mastering the general flow of play.

The highest row of the grid typically features the most popular and straightforward wagers available to players, such as the Small and Big options. A Small wager wins if the total value of the three dice falls between four and ten, excluding triples. Conversely, a Big bet covers totals from eleven to seventeen, offering the most stable probability for those starting out.

Navigating High-Yield Combinations Wisely

Beyond the simple even-money wagers, the centralized game board features specific total bets ranging from four to seventeen. Each specific total comes with unique payout odds that reflect how mathematically difficult it is to roll that precise sum. For instance, hitting a total of four or seventeen pays out significantly higher than rolling a common ten or eleven.

The riskiest options on the table layout are triple bets, where a player predicts that all three dice will land on the exact same number. While these combinations offer massive payouts, they also carry a steep house advantage that can quickly deplete your capital.
